'My Son Wore My Thong'

What if you caught your son wearing your undies?
Recently, we heard about a Mom who saw her son sporting her thong and it created a buzz in our office. How should a mom react to
this situation?
Momlogic friend Counseling Mom weighs in on the issue:
"You need to talk to your child and find out what's going on. It's not perverse, but you have to understand that this may (or may not) be the start of something that not even he realizes. It's a dangerous world--if one of his classmates sees his choice of clothing, they might beat him up because they think he's a 'freak.'
Be open to more conversations about this topic in the future, and educate yourself, even talking to a counselor if you feel you need guidance, so that you can be supportive of your child."
